Owner Comments:

This is an extremely rare (pop 1 of 1) and special coin. It has the distinction of the being the first and only NGC graded 1878-P in a GSA holder. For VAM fans, it is also special in that it is the first GSA variety identified as a VAM 41A. I would like to thank Lewis Rosenbaum, an expert in GSA Morgans, for his excellent investigative work in determining the VAM, which was confirmed by NGC during the grading process. I am aware that there are other ungraded 1878-P’s in the GSA holders out there (at least two, and possibly more), but they have been identified as VAM 37. This coin is bright white, but is fairly baggy around the cheek area and on the obverse in general. I am including a close-up picture of the reverse tail feathers, which was used to confirm the variety.
